How Hardwood Floor Water Extraction Actually Works

When water damage strikes, every minute counts. That’s why our team follows a proven process to ensure your hardwood floors are restored to their original condition. We’ll start by assessing the damage, identifying the source of the water, and containing the affected area to prevent further damage.

Step 1: Assessment and Containment

We’ll use specialized equipment to measure the moisture levels in your hardwood floors and identify the extent of the damage. This helps us find out the best course of action and ensure that our containment procedures are effective. We use state-of-the-art moisture meters to get the job done right.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Using powerful pumps and wet vacuums, our team will extract as much water as possible from your hardwood floors. This is a critical step in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th. We use high-capacity pumps to get the job done fast.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water has been extracted, we’ll use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ify your hardwood floors. This helps to prevent mold growth and ensures that your floors are safe and secure. We use industrial-grade dehumidifiers to speed up the drying process.

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fection

Finally, we’ll clean and disinfect your hardwood floors to remove any dirt, debris, or bacteria that may have been present. This ensures that your floors are safe and healthy for you and your family. We use eco-friendly cleaning products to get the job done right.

Warning Signs You Need Hardwood Floor Water Extraction

Water damage can be sneaky, and it’s often hard to detect until it’s too late. But there are warning signs you can look out for to prevent further damage and ensure your hardwood floors are safe and secure. Don’t ignore these signs, they could save you thousands of dollars in repairs.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it could be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ore it, it’s a warning sign that your hardwood floors are at risk.

Warped or Buckled Hardwood Floors

If your hardwood floors are warped or buckled, it could be a sign of water damage. Don’t wait, address the issue now to prevent further damage.

Water Stains or Discoloration

If you notice water stains or discoloration on your hardwood floors, it could be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ore it, it’s a warning sign that your floors are at risk.

Increased Moisture Levels

If you notice an increase in moisture levels in your home, it could be a sign of water damage. Don’t wait, address the issue now to prevent further damage.

Unusual Sounds or Creaks

If you notice unusual sounds or creaks in your hardwood floors, it could be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ore it, it’s a warning sign that your floors are at risk.

Hardwood Floor Water Extraction Cost In Mineral Wells, TX

The cost of Hardwood Floor Water Extraction can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Mineral Wells, TX. We’ll work with you to provide a customized estimate and ensure you get the best value for your money.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Containment $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ed.
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ed.
Drying and Dehumidification $300 – $1,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ed.
Cleaning and Disinfection $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ed.
Moisture Testing and Inspection $100 – $500 Size of affected area and severity of damage.
